WebThe Virginia Constitution of 1870 mandated a system of public education for the first time, but the newly established schools were operated on a segregated basis. Despite social and economic challenges, African Americans pursued education with great fervor. WebAmelia Elizabeth Perry Pride (27 March 1857 or 1858–4 June 1932), educator and civic leader, was born free in Lynchburg and was the daughter of Ellen George Perry and William Perry, a master carpenter and building contractor.
